Summary of this Book...
Time no longer exists, eternity takes forever to pass, and I am trapped in a late night which will never end. And so ends the first story in New Orleans native Todd Sullivan's collection of short stories, poems and novella titled One Hour. The book is a journey through the world of drugs, party scenes and the supernatural as seen through the eyes of a writer willing to take an unusual look at everyday life. Sullivan s poetry is haunting and encompasses the fears and anxieties that fill us all. His poem Distance Lost, is about a boy's fear of the Boogie Man and their trading places. The boy,/ looking,/ staring,/ accepts, / trades places, and the first soul he has that day, for breakfast,/ instead of cereal,/ is his mother's/ son's/ imposter. The author s discussion of drug culture intermingled with party life is about as frank and honest as it gets. It s so frank in fact that it may be a bit upsetting to some weak-hearted readers used to turning the pages of baby-mama-drama novels. On his website, Sullivan stated during a writing workshop he attended with Dorothy Allison, author of Bastard Out of Carolina, she gave some advice: every good first novel is autobiographical. So is the novella at the end of the book, The Great Escape Artist. The Great Escape Artist is definitely an embellished biography of the past 24 years of my life, he said. I am indeed a Pisces, I grew up in New Orleans one mile from Pontchartrain Park, my mother is a teacher, my father is a stock broker and most importantly of all, I am a dreamer. Pisces are supposed to be the supreme dreamers, but I think everyone can identify with the main character of 'The Great Escape Artist, Lore Simmons. No matter how reality minded a person is, they dream, even if their dreams are only allowed to flourish while they sleep. Overall, One Hour is a welcome diversion from the mundane cookie-cutter books saturating the market today. But buyer beware: only read this one if you re not going anywhere for a while because you won t want to put it down. - Xavier Herald, by L.M. Aaron
